    Scorpene data leak: Why don't you order a probe, Congress asks Manohar Parrikar

    NEW DELHI: The Congress has alleged that fresh revelations in the Australian media ‘clearly pointed’ to the possibility of vital secret security details of the Scorpene submarine of the Indian fleet might have been exposed. It demanded to know why the defence minister was ‘shying away’ from ordering a probe headed by a sitting Supreme Court judge.

    “We may have a situation where the first Scorpene of our fleet may stand compromised. This means stealth capabilities of the sub stand compromised. This is important because the first of the 6 Scorpene fleet that is undergoing trials. The propulsion mechanism of the boat, which goes to the basic design of the submarine, is also out in the public domain due to the leak.

    Yet, why the Modi government, especially the defence minister, is not willing to order a probe headed by a sitting Supreme Court judge and conduct a security audit of the ministry of defence”, AICC spokesperson Manish Tewari asked at the official party briefing in New Delhi on Monday. “If the frequencies of the sonar system are out in the public domain, our adversaries can easily take advantage. Which also means the security and safety of that submarine stands compromised.

    The DNA of any submarine is its opacity. Every boat has a specific signature. Experts have now said if details about that signature are leaked then vital security details will be out.

    Has the government of India initiated some steps, under the terms of contract, in order to mitigate the situation,” Tewari asked.
